Gem ruby download linux

How do i install rubygems package manager for ruby on rails ror under debian or ubuntu linux operating systems. Rubygems is a package management application for ruby that is used to quickly and easily distribute rubyrails applications and libraries. Oct 14, 2018 however, you can follow the steps below to determine if ruby is installed and, if not, install the ruby interpreter on your linux computer. How to install ruby on linux for an ubuntubased distribution, follow the following procedure to verify whether you have ruby installed, and if not, to install it. H ow do i install rubygems package manager for ruby on rails ror under debian or ubuntu linux operating systems. If youre brand new to sass weve set up some resources to help you learn pretty. Bitnami ruby stack provides a complete development environment for rails. Ive reinstalled linux mint 20 time in last 3 days for that issue but could not fix it. In the following guide, im going to walk you through how to install ruby on rails for ubuntu linux. Please can any one helpi have similar issue but im very new to this command line stuffgem is in at usrbingem, ruby st. Do you want to know where your ruby binary is installed. Im trying to install ruby on rails using rvm what happened is if start a new linux installation and try installing gems and ruby and stuff in one terminal session it installed successfully as soon as i close the terminal session i cant get those gems.

Rubys difficulties on windows stem from the fact that its very different, under the covers, from both linux and macos. Gosu is focused, lightweight and has few dependencies mostly sdl 2. Given a list of gems, it can automatically download and install those gems, as well as any other gems needed by the gems that are listed. In this tutorial we recommend that you use ruby version manager rvm for this purpose. Rubygems is a package manager for the ruby programming language that provides a standard format for distributing ruby programs and libraries in. Here you can get the latest ruby distributions in your favorite flavor.

Each installer includes all of the software necessary to run out of the box the stack. Jekyll is a ruby gem that can be installed on most systems. Installing ruby gems in the users home directory faruk adam. Rvm ruby version manager is a tool for installing and managing multiple ruby versions on single operating systems.

However, you can follow the steps below to determine if ruby is installed and, if not, install the ruby interpreter on your linux computer. Rubygems is for ruby as aptget and yum are to linux. Installing ruby with rvm deployment walkthrough with. On linuxunix, you can use the package management system of your distribution or thirdparty tools rbenv and rvm. To do this, we will use the ruby version manager you installed when you did your original system install. If you are planning on doing any development in ruby, this is a must have. If gem list does not show all gems you previously had, you can create a symlink to your old gem directory. It provides the biggest number of compatible gems and installs msys2devkit alongside ruby, so that gems with cextensions can be compiled immediately. Rubygems is a package management framework for ruby. In this doc, you will learn how to install rubygems on linux. Asciidoctor is a fast, open source text processor and publishing toolchain for converting asciidoc content to html5, docbook, pdf, and other formats.

When the user installs this source gem on the destination computer, gem attempts to compile the extra code as part of the installation. A package manager organizes packages during development of an application. Compiling from source nokogiri source gems can also be compiled and installed using rubyinstaller plus devkit. Written by joe burgess updated over a week ago to upgrade from ruby 2. The popular ruby on rails web framework also powers many large websites, meaning ruby is here to stay. To upgrade rubygems or install it for the first time if you need to use ruby 1. I have included instructions for both ubuntu and centos. This is considered the best way to manage gems on arch, because otherwise they might interfere with gems installed by pacman. Jan, 2017 rubygems is a package manager for the ruby programming language that provides a standard format for distributing ruby programs and libraries in a selfcontained format called a gem, a tool. Then turn of the windows feature for linux subsystem and follow the installation steps again. Setup ruby on rails on windows 10 ubuntu linux subsystem. Asciidoctor is written in ruby and runs on all major operating systems. The following command installs ruby gem for ubuntu. If you want to see how to require files from a gem, skip ahead to what is a gem.

This reference was automatically generated from rubygems version 3. The advantage of shipping a gem this way is that the nonruby code will bind to the actual libraries that are installed on the destination computer. Please can any one helpi have similar issue but im very new to this command line stuffgem is in at usrbingem, ruby st usrbinruby. It is built upon msys1, which is no longer maintained, now. We will use bundler in this tutorial, so let us install it. Heres how to create a gemset for an application named myapp and create. Before you can deploy your app on the production server, you need to install ruby. The best way to build a gem is to use a rakefile and the gempackagetask which ships with rubygems. First, we need to install some dependencies for ruby environment. The best way to build a gem is to use a rakefile and the gem packagetask which ships with rubygems. How to install ruby on linux for an ubuntubased distribution, follow the following procedure to verify whether you have ruby installed, and if. It can also sometimes reveal the version you are using as it is usually part of directory structure. How to install ruby on rails with rbenv on ubuntu 16. Browse other questions tagged ruby linux rubygems or ask your own.

The gem program will download and install that version of the rails gem, along with all the other gems rails depends on. Browse other questions tagged ruby linux rubygems or ask your own question. Asciidoctor a fast, open source text processor and. May 01, 20 h ow do i install rubygems package manager for ruby on rails ror under debian or ubuntu linux operating systems. Rubygems is a package manager for the ruby programming. In order for rvm to automatically use its version of ruby whenever you open a new terminal window, your terminal has to open a login shell, as rvm modifies the. Bundler makes sure ruby applications run the same code on every machine. This is a tarball of whatever is in git, made nightly. Become a contributor and improve the site yourself is made possible through a partnership with the greater ruby community. Dec 06, 2016 install ruby on rails ubuntu linux by daniel kehoe. If you need to manage aws resources from within your application, install the aws sdk for ruby. Bitnami ruby stack installers bitnami native installers automate the setup of a bitnami application stack on windows, mac os and linux. The ruby programming language, combined with the rails development framework, makes app development simple.

It does this by managing the gems that the application depends on. Lets take a look at how to set up a functioning ruby environment on your windows computer. If you dont have any rubygems installed, there is still the pregem approach to getting software, doing it manually. Its available for macos, windows, linux including raspbian, and ios. Rubygems supports shipping nonruby source code in the gem. In this tutorial we will show you three different ways to install ruby on ubuntu 18. This guide will work with any ubuntu linux version, including the latest lts version ubuntu 18.

Sep 21, 2018 ruby is one of the most popular languages today. If you need to install ruby, see the following guides. By default in arch linux, when running gem, gems are installed peruser into. This may contain bugs or other issues, use at your own risk. To simplify installation, asciidoctor is packaged and distributed as a rubygem. Verify that ruby was properly installed by printing the version number. If you are installing ruby in order to use ruby on rails, you can use the following installer. Installation jekyll simple, blogaware, static sites. Locally run amazon linux 2 for ruby on rails development. On linux unix, you can use the package management system of your distribution or thirdparty tools rbenv and rvm. Become a contributor and improve the site yourself. Rvm is a tool for installing and managing multiple ruby versions.

But avoid asking for help, clarification, or responding to other answers. Before we can take ruby out for a spin, lets make one more modification to our system. It supports macos, linux, windows, virtual machines, and cloud images. How to install ruby on rails with rvm on ubuntu 16. Uptodate, detailed instructions for the rails newest release.

Ruby is a dynamic, objectoriented programming language focused on simplicity and productivity. If youve already created an application with the command rails new myapp, you can still create a projectspecific gemset. If you have an older version of rubygems installed, then you can still do it in two steps. This might be necessary if the binary gem doesnt work with your ruby version. You can also run sass help for more information about the commandline interface. There will be plenty of different gamemodes, theme and networksupport. We have several tools on each major platform to install ruby. Installing ruby with rvm deployment walkthrough with ruby. But if you just want to install a gem that you have on your local machine, all you need to do from the console is go into the directory containing your gem and gem install local your. Bundler is a popular tool for managing application gem dependencies. Setting up your ruby development environment aws elastic. You can begin install gems by using the gem install command.

It has an elegant syntax and it is the language behind the powerful ruby on rails framework. In this tutorial we will show you three different ways to install ruby on ubuntu. Note that gem will download and use a version of the gem appropriate for your system and architecture e. Ruby on rails is one of the most popular application stacks for developers looking to create sites and web apps. Alternatively a manual download and installation from msys2 is also possible. The build command allows you to create a gem from a ruby gemspec. Rubygems is a package management application for ruby that is used to quickly and easily distribute ruby rails applications and libraries. First install sass using one of the options below, then run sass version to be sure it installed correctly. Installing ruby and rails can be tricky, if you dont do it the right way. The gem command allows you to interact with rubygems. This tutorial will help you to install rvm on your system. Rubygems is for ruby as aptget and yum are to linux operating systems. May 27, 2006 rubygems supports shipping nonruby source code in the gem. Aug 16, 2016 a gem is a library, a collection of reusable code, that can be automatically downloaded and installed on your system, using the gem tool.

581 1039 660 205 681 1288 1585 1527 835 50 1331 660 844 407 1312 399 1283 1424 161 1300 429 1033 434 38 600 1357 596 314 1089 1271 1129 298 79 326 961 693 24